2016 TWD to NZD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2016

During 2016, the TWD to NZD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 19, valuing the pair at 0.0466.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on July 8, dropping to 0.0424.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0042 NZD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0457 to the December average rate of 0.0445, the exchange rate registered a net change of -2.70%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2016 high of 0.0466 was down 5.33% compared to the 2015 peak of 0.0492,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 0.0451, compared to 0.0440 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 0.0011 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2016 was July, with a trading range of 0.0024 NZD (High: 0.0448 / Low: 0.0424). On the other end, February was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0011 NZD (High: 0.0458 / Low: 0.0447).
